Design Sprints have become an extremely popular format in businesses. However, many sprint projects never get executed because they are not aligned with the business context.
Tim Höfer is a product design director and head of the design sprint team at the AJ&Smart, which has run sprints for companies like Google, Slack, Lyft, and Lufthansa.
In this episode, we spoke about integrating business thinking with design sprints. We explored:
how competitive research can completely reshape sprint’s goal,
why many design sprint projects never get executed,
and a new sprint format: Strategy Sprint.
